Physiotherapy for Posterior Fossa Ataxia: A Complete Guide

Addressing cerebellar ataxia requires a targeted physiotherapy program . The guide explores the essential components of rehab interventions aimed at enhancing equilibrium , motor control and functional living. We'll examine a breakdown of common strategies:

  • Equilibrium exercises - employing dynamic surfaces and movements to boost postural control.
  • Gait training - concentrating on patterning and lessening compensatory actions .
  • Dexterity development - employing specific drills to refine accuracy in intentional actions.
  • Stretching and mobility work - aiming to maintain joint health and lessen rigidity .
  • Assistive device familiarization - teaching the correct use of canes and other assistive devices .

Furthermore a complete assessment by a qualified physiotherapist is essential to create an personalized therapy plan addressing the unique difficulties faced by each individual .
